Heritage is much more than a residential treatment school. It incorporates excellent therapeutic options from one-on-one counseling, group work, recreation therapy, and a comprehensive phase program. In addition, their support for each family is compassionate, educational, and comprehensive. Our son is doing great and has learned so much at this amazing place.
